Last week, the Hotel Association and the La Romana-Bayahíbe Cluster began the vaccination process of all the employees of tourism companies and hotels that are part of the La Romana destination.
The initiative is part of the National Vaccination Strategy, developed by the Health Cabinet, led by the Vice President of the Republic, Raquel Peña, to stop the local spread of the virus and promote the country as a safe destination for tourism. international.
The entity indicated that during the operative, more than 3,500 people, belonging to the entire value chain of the tourism sector, have already received their first dose of the Sinovac vaccine, in a process carried out under the coordination of the Ministry of Public Health and with the support from the Ministry of Tourism, Civil Defense and Viva Wyndham Dominicus, Hilton La Romana, Whala! Bayahibe, Iberostar Selection Hacienda Dominicus, Catalonia Gran Dominicus & Royal, Dreams Dominicus, Be Live Collection Canoa and Casa de Campo Resort & Villas.

Andrés Fernández, president of the Hotel Association and the La Romana-Bayahibe Cluster, said that this vaccination process is an important step in attracting international markets, and stressed that, once again, the union of the different actors of the destination They have made the process a success, thus managing to vaccinate not only the hotel sector but also excursion employees and the rest of the complimentary offer, which will make the destination 100% immunized in less than a month.
“At the La Romana destination, we are committed to contributing to the recovery of the tourism sector in the area. Part of the strategy is to strengthen our employees’ health and safety systems to guarantee that of our visitors,” explained Fernández.
Likewise, he stated that these actions allow the country to move forward to continue maintaining itself as the leading tourist destination in the Caribbean.
